Ingredients You’ll Need for This Creamy Chicken Pot Pie Orzo

Gathering your ingredients is the first step towards creating something special.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• 1 pound boneless, skinless chicken breasts, diced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 medium on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 cup carrots, diced
  • 1 cup peas (fresh or frozen)
  • 2 cups chicken broth
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1 1/2 cups orzo pasta
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ried rosemary
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

You can easily substitute the chicken with turkey or even tofu for a vegetarian twist. If you’re out of heavy cream, a combination of milk and butter can also work wonders.

Steps to Create Your Creamy Chicken Pot Pie Orzo

Follow these steps, and you’ll have this delightful dish ready in no time:

  1.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the diced chicken, season with salt and pepper, and cook until browned and cooked through, about 5-7 minutes. Remove the chicken from the skillet and set aside.
  2. In the same skillet, add the chopped onion and sauté until translucent, about 3 minutes.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for an additional minute.
  3. Add the carrots and peas, sautéing them until the carrots are tender, approximately 5 minutes.
  4. Pour in the chicken broth and bring it to a simmer. Stir in the orzo, thyme, and rosemary, cooking until the orzo is al dente, about 8-10 minutes. Stir occasionally to prevent sticking.
  5. Reduce the heat to low, and add the heavy cream, stirring until well combined. Return the cooked chicken to the skillet, allowing everything to heat through.
  6. Stir in the Parmesan cheese until melted and the sauce is creamy. Taste and adjust seasoning as needed.
  7. Garnish with fresh parsley before serving.

Tips for Making the Best Creamy Chicken Pot Pie Orzo

Here are some of my personal tips to ensure your dish turns out perfectly:

  • Pre-cook the Chicken: Searing the chicken first not only locks in the juices but also adds a depth of flavor to the dish.
  • Stir Often: Orzo can stick to the pan, so keep it moving as it cooks. This also helps to evenly distribute the flavors.
  • Adjust Consistency: If the dish seems too thick, add a splash of chicken broth or cream to reach your desired consistency.
  • Flavor to Your Liking: Feel free to add a pinch of nutmeg or a splash of white wine for an extra layer of flavor.

Serving Suggestions and Pairings

Final dish - Cozy Up with Creamy Chicken Pot Pie Orzo Bliss

This Creamy Chicken Pot Pie Orzo is a meal in itself, but here are a few pairings to elevate your dining experience:

  • Green Salad: A fresh salad with a light vinaigrette complements the richness of the orzo.
  • Crusty Bread: Serve with warm bread to soak up every bit of the creamy sauce.
  • White Wine: A crisp Chardonnay or Sauvignon Blanc pairs beautifully with the dish’s creamy texture.

Storage and Reheating Tips

To make the most of any leftovers, here are some storage and reheating tips:

  • Storage: Allow the orzo to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. It will keep in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
  • Reheating: Reheat gently on the stovetop over low heat, adding a splash of chicken broth or cream to restore the creamy texture.
  • Freezing: While I prefer it fresh, you can freeze the dish for up to a month.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.
